Our North Wales response homes offer an immediate response for young people who may be experiencing a crisis in their life.

Placements are generally 3 month programmes with supported transitions into their next longer term placement.

 

Our young people are offered a specially tailored programme containing a considerable amount of outdoor activities provided by the staff team throughout their stay. This provides the young people with fun and new opportunities, but also space and time to work through their difficulties and seek the help and support they need.
